Output 11cbdc49fcb4ef83107fcc76f46f98d5715fd03a6c07431eb319e984d4625e6a: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 747e5e5cc8cc2e3ac94fbe23213cecac57b668f2 OP_EQUAL
address
3CJyh3JicNPZuWA6wJFQijNKD1jfKhx8sb
transaction
11cbdc49fcb4ef83107fcc76f46f98d5715fd03a6c07431eb319e984d4625e6a
confirmations
511623
spent
true